How to Choose the Right End of Line Automation System
Selecting the ideal end of line automation equipment comes down to balancing payload capacity with system modularity. While raw speed and reach are critical for heavy automotive parts, the ability to quickly reprogram and redeploy vision-guided cells offers the flexibility needed for changing production lines.
Look closely at the payload-to-reach ratio rather than just maximum weight capacity, as extending a robotic arm fully often reduces its safe handling weight.
Ignore vague marketing claims of seamless integration; instead, verify direct compatibility with your existing Warehouse Management System and Programmable Logic Controllers.
If your facility handles multiple SKUs with frequent changeovers, prioritize collaborative robots with vision-guided systems over traditional fixed-fence industrial robots.
Evaluate the system footprint and safety requirements, ensuring the equipment includes advanced area scanners if your floor space does not permit hard guarding.
